The Rise of Social Commerce
Social commerce combines the reach and engagement of social media with the transactional functionality of e-commerce. It allows brands to sell products directly through social media platforms, such as Instagram, Facebook, Pinterest, and TikTok. This model leverages the influence of social media, where billions of people spend a significant portion of their time.
Why Social Commerce Works
Seamless Shopping Experience: Social commerce integrates shopping with social media browsing, offering a seamless and convenient experience. Customers can discover, browse, and purchase apparel without ever leaving their favorite apps.
Influencer Marketing: Influencers play a crucial role in social commerce. Their endorsements and reviews can significantly drive sales, as followers often trust their opinions and are influenced by their style.
User-Generated Content: Customers sharing their purchases and experiences on social media act as authentic testimonials. This user-generated content serves as powerful social proof, encouraging others to buy.
Targeted Advertising: Social media platforms offer sophisticated targeting options. Brands can reach specific demographics, interests, and behaviors, ensuring their apparel reaches the right audience.
Engagement and Community Building: Social media allows brands to engage directly with customers, building a sense of community and loyalty. This interaction can lead to higher customer retention and repeat purchases.
Key Platforms for Social Commerce
Instagram Shopping is a dominant force in social commerce. Brands can create shoppable posts and stories, allowing users to click on a product tag and make a purchase directly. Features like Instagram Live Shopping also enable real-time product showcases and sales.
Facebook Shops provides a customizable storefront within Facebook and Instagram. It allows businesses to showcase their products, integrate with e-commerce platforms, and offer a cohesive shopping experience. Live Shopping events on Facebook also drive real-time sales and engagement.
Pinterest’s visual nature makes it ideal for fashion. Pinterest Shopping enables users to discover and purchase products directly from pins. Rich Pins and Buyable Pins streamline the shopping process, turning inspiration into transactions.
TikTok
TikTok's explosive growth and its focus on short-form video content make it a powerful platform for social commerce. TikTok Shopping allows brands to add shopping tabs to their profiles and integrate product links in videos, turning viral content into sales opportunities.
Best Practices for Selling Apparel Through Social Media
Create High-Quality Visual Content
High-quality images and videos are essential in showcasing apparel effectively. Use professional photography, engaging videos, and visually appealing layouts to attract and retain customers.
Leverage Influencer Partnerships
Collaborate with influencers whose audience aligns with your target market. Influencer partnerships can significantly boost visibility and credibility, driving more traffic and sales to your social commerce channels.
Engage with Your Audience
Respond to comments, messages, and reviews promptly. Engaging with your audience builds trust and fosters a sense of community. Host live sessions, Q&A segments, and behind-the-scenes content to keep your followers engaged.
Utilize Analytics
Use analytics tools provided by social media platforms to track performance. Monitor key metrics such as engagement rates, click-through rates, and conversion rates. Use this data to refine your strategy and optimize your social commerce efforts.
Offer Exclusive Deals
Incentivize your social media followers with exclusive deals and promotions. Limited-time offers, flash sales, and discount codes can create urgency and drive quick sales.
The Future of Social Commerce in Apparel
The integration of AR (Augmented Reality) and AI (Artificial Intelligence) is set to further revolutionize social commerce. AR allows customers to virtually try on clothes, while AI provides personalized shopping experiences and recommendations. As these technologies advance, they will make shopping on social media even more immersive and tailored.
